The Cigar Smoking World Championship

The Cigar Smoking World Championship grand finale will be held in Split, Croatia,  from September 2 to September 4, culling the finalists from a field of nearly 3,000 participants from all over the world. The weekend wraps a season of over 70 competitions in over 35 countries.

The Cigar Smoking World Championship is a contest  in which contestants  compete in how slow they can smoke their cigar, with time penalties given for such things as breaking your ash or burning the cigar band. The smoker who takes the longest to finish their cigar is the winner.

Drew Emck from the U.S has recorded the best time of the season at 3:19:24. Hauke Walter from Germany, the 2018 world champion, finished right behind him by 22 seconds.
